Here is the BARC question paper for Eletcrical
1 Differential amplifiers are used in
a. instrumentation amplifiers
b. voltage followers
c. voltage regulators
d. buffers

3 The ideal OP-AMP has the following characteristics.
a) Ri=? ,A=? ,R0=0
b) Ri=0 ,A=? ,R0=0
c) Ri=? ,A=? ,R0=?
d) Ri=0 ,A=? ,R0=?

5 A very brief, high voltage spike on an ac power line is called as
A. A bleeder
B. An arc
C. A transient
D. An avalanche
E. A clipped peak

6 You can find the zener diode in
A. The mixer in a superheterodyne receiver
B. The PLL in a circuit for detecting FM
C. The product detector in a receiver for SSB
D. The voltage regulator in a power supply
E. The AF oscillator in an AFSK transmitter

7 A network function can be completely specified by:
(A) Real parts of zeros
(B)Poles and zeros
(C)Real parts of poles
(D)Poles, zeros and a scale factor

8 A unit impulse voltage is applied to one port network having two linear components. If the current through the network is 0 for t<0 and decaysexponentially for t>0then the network consists of
(A) R and L in series
(B)R and L in parallel
(C)R and C in parallel
(D)R and C in series

9 The Q-factor of a parallel resonance circuit consisting of an inductance of value 1mH, capacitance of value 10-5 F and a resistance of 100 ohms is
(A) 1
(B)10
(C) ? 20
(D) 100

10 In a travelling electromagnetic wave, E and H vector fields are
(A) perpendicular in space .
(B) parallel in space.
(C) E is in the direction of wave travel.
(D) H is in the direction of wave travel.

11 The lower cut -off frequency of a rectangular wave guide with inside dimensions (3 × 4.5 cm) operating at 10 GHz is
(A) 10 GHz.
(B)9 GHz.
(C) 10/9GHz.
(D) 10/3GHz

12 The intrinsic impedance of free space is
(A) 75 ohm.
(B)73 ohm.
(C)120 ? ohm.
(D)377ohm

13 Which one of the following conditions will not guarantee a distortion less transmission line
(A)R = 0 = G
(B)RC = LG
(C) very low frequency range (R>> ? L, G >> ? C)
(D) very high frequency range (R<< ? L, G << ? C)

14 MOSFET can be used as a
(a) current controlled capacitor
(b) voltage controlled capacitor
(c) current controlled inductor
(d) voltage controlled inductors

15 In a common emitter, unbypassed resister provides
(a)voltage shunt feedback
(b)current series feedback
(c)negative voltage feedback
(d)positive current feedback

16 Introducing a resistor in the emitter of a common amplifier stabilizes the dc operating point against variations in
a) Only the temperature
b) only the ? of the transistor
c) Both Temperature & ?
d) None of the above

17 For the circuit shown in Fig.4, the voltage across the last resistor is V.All resistors are of ? 1 .The Vs is given by
(A) 13V.
(B) 8V.
(C) 4V.
(D)1V

18 The network has a network function Z(s)=s(s+2)/(s+3)(s+4)
(A)not a positive real function.
(B)RL network.
(C) RC network.
(D)LC network

19 For a series R-C circuit excited by a d-c voltageof 10V, and with time-constant s, , ? the voltage across C at time ? = t is given by
A.10(1-e-1) v
B.10(2-e-2) v
C.10-e-1volts
D.1-e-1

20 A 2 port network using Z parameter representation is said to bereciprocal if
A.Z11=Z22
B.Z12=Z21
C.Z12=-Z21
D.Z11–2Z22=0
